| /** |
| * Parameters that can be given during http request creation. Application |
| * must initialize this structure with #pj_http_req_param_default(). |
| */ |
| typedef struct pj_http_req_param |
| { |
| /** |
| * The address family of the URL. |
| * Default is pj_AF_INET(). |
| */ |
| int addr_family; |
| |
| /** |
| * The HTTP request method. |
| * Default is GET. |
| */ |
| pj_str_t method; |
| |
| /** |
| * The HTTP protocol version ("1.0" or "1.1"). |
| * Default is "1.0". |
| */ |
| pj_str_t version; |
| |
| /** |
| * HTTP request operation timeout. |
| * Default is PJ_HTTP_DEFAULT_TIMEOUT. |
| */ |
| pj_time_val timeout; |
| |
| /** |
| * User-defined data. |
| * Default is NULL. |
| */ |
| void *user_data; |
| |
| /** |
| * HTTP request headers. |
| * Default is empty. |
| */ |
| pj_http_headers headers; |
| |
| /** |
| * This structure describes the http request body. If application |
| * specifies the data to send, the data must remain valid until |
| * the HTTP request is sent. Alternatively, application can choose |
| * to specify total_size as the total data size to send instead |
| * while leaving the data NULL (and its size 0). In this case, |
| * HTTP request will then call on_send_data() callback once it is |
| * ready to send the request body. This will be useful if |
| * application does not wish to load the data into the buffer at |
| * once. |
| * |
| * Default is empty. |
| */ |
| struct pj_http_reqdata |
| { |
| void *data; /**< Request body data */ |
| pj_size_t size; /**< Request body size */ |
| pj_size_t total_size; /**< If total_size > 0, data */ |
| /**< will be provided later */ |
| } reqdata; |
| |
| /** |
| * Authentication credential needed to respond to 401/407 response. |
| */ |
| pj_http_auth_cred auth_cred; |
| |
| /** |
| * Optional source port range to use when binding the socket. |
| * This can be used if the source port needs to be within a certain range |
| * for instance due to strict firewall settings. The port used will be |
| * randomized within the range. |
| * |
| * Note that if authentication is configured, the authentication response |
| * will be a new transaction |
| * |
| * Default is 0 (The OS will select the source port automatically) |
| */ |
| pj_uint16_t source_port_range_start; |
| |
| /** |
| * Optional source port range to use when binding. |
| * The size of the port restriction range |
| * |
| * Default is 0 (The OS will select the source port automatically)) |
| */ |
| pj_uint16_t source_port_range_size; |
| |
| /** |
| * Max number of retries if binding to a port fails. |
| * Note that this does not adress the scenario where a request times out |
| * or errors. This needs to be taken care of by the on_complete callback. |
| * |
| * Default is 3 |
| */ |
| pj_uint16_t max_retries; |
| |
| } pj_http_req_param; |

| /** |
| * This structure describes the callbacks to be called by the HTTP request. |
| */ |
| typedef struct pj_http_req_callback |
| { |
| /** |
| * This callback is called when a complete HTTP response header |
| * is received. |
| * |
| * @param http_req The http request. |
| * @param resp The response of the request. |
| */ |
| void (*on_response)(pj_http_req *http_req, const pj_http_resp *resp); |
| |
| /** |
| * This callback is called when the HTTP request is ready to send |
| * its request body. Application may wish to use this callback if |
| * it wishes to load the data at a later time or if it does not |
| * wish to load the whole data into memory. In order for this |
| * callback to be called, application MUST set http_req_param.total_size |
| * to a value greater than 0. |
| * |
| * @param http_req The http request. |
| * @param data Pointer to the data that will be sent. Application |
| * must set the pointer to the current data chunk/segment |
| * to be sent. Data must remain valid until the next |
| * on_send_data() callback or for the last segment, |
| * until it is sent. |
| * @param size Pointer to the data size that will be sent. |
| */ |
| void (*on_send_data)(pj_http_req *http_req, |
| void **data, pj_size_t *size); |
| |
| /** |
| * This callback is called when a segment of response body data |
| * arrives. If this callback is specified (i.e. not NULL), the |
| * on_complete() callback will be called with zero-length data |
| * (within the response parameter), hence the application must |
| * store and manage its own data buffer, otherwise the |
| * on_complete() callback will be called with the response |
| * parameter containing the complete data. |
| * |
| * @param http_req The http request. |
| * @param data The buffer containing the data. |
| * @param size The length of data in the buffer. |
| */ |
| void (*on_data_read)(pj_http_req *http_req, |
| void *data, pj_size_t size); |
| |
| /** |
| * This callback is called when the HTTP request is completed. |
| * If the callback on_data_read() is specified, the variable |
| * response->data will be set to NULL, otherwise it will |
| * contain the complete data. Response data is allocated from |
| * pj_http_req's internal memory pool so the data remain valid |
| * as long as pj_http_req is not destroyed and application does |
| * not start a new request. |
| * |
| * If no longer required, application may choose to destroy |
| * pj_http_req immediately by calling #pj_http_req_destroy() inside |
| * the callback. |
| * |
| * @param http_req The http request. |
| * @param status The status of the request operation. PJ_SUCCESS |
| * if the operation completed successfully |
| * (connection-wise). To check the server's |
| * status-code response to the HTTP request, |
| * application should check resp->status_code instead. |
| * @param resp The response of the corresponding request. If |
| * the status argument is non-PJ_SUCCESS, this |
| * argument will be set to NULL. |
| */ |
| void (*on_complete)(pj_http_req *http_req, |
| pj_status_t status, |
| const pj_http_resp *resp); |
| |
| } pj_http_req_callback; |
